With the ET product models, the remote control lets the user manage key camera functions, including zoom, recording, photo and video modes, power, and snapshot capture.
The ET models come fully equipped with everything you need to start capturing footage right out of the box, including the tower/monopod, brackets, camera, monitor, electronics, and more. The NE model, which stands for "No Electronics Included," offers the same frame and structural components as the ET, but without the electronic parts. It includes the frame, brackets, and other structural elements. The PT model, which stands for "Pole and Tripod Included," features a telescopic pole and tripod base, making it an excellent choice for users who want to add custom components or build their own setup. All models come with their respective carrying bags for easy transport.
The viewing monitor at the base allows the user to see exactly what the camera above is capturing.
Yes, the viewing monitor is equipped with a sun visor designed to mitigate glare and optimize visibility and ensuring consistent image quality during use.
